UEFA has opened an investigation into Vinicius Junior’s allegations of racist abuse but Gianluca Prestianni, the player accused, is likely to be available to play in next week’s second leg between Real Madrid and Benfica at the Bernabeu.
European football’s governing body has appointed an ethics and disciplinary inspector, given the case is so high profile, to gather evidence from speaking to those involved.
Sources with knowledge of the process do not expect a swift resolution with the investigation likely to stretch into weeks rather than days.
